longitudinal flagellum

Term ID
GO:0097609
Synonyms
  • longitudinal cilium
Definition
A motile cilium found in dinoflagellates. It trails the cell and acts as a steering rudder. It is often partially contained in a furrow called the sulcus, and emerges from a flagellar pore located in the sulcus. (4)
